Mesut Ozil has said he is looking forward to playing with “ice cold” Alexandre Lacazette.

Since Ozil arrived at Arsenal, we’ve all been looking forward to the day he could link up with a quick and prolific striker.

The German has provided many assists for the likes of Olivier Giroud, Theo Walcott and Alexis Sanchez, and will now have the opportunity to play with Lacazette.

Speaking to Arsenal Player, Ozil revealed he is eager to link-up with the Frenchman.

“I’m really looking forward to it,” Ozil said.

“He’s a very good striker who has scored many goals in Ligue 1, not just this season but in previous seasons too. We’re really happy to have such a class striker here with us.

“From what I’ve heard, he’s meant to be very good, always hungry for goals and ice-cold when he gets into a scoring position. My friends who follow the French league know him well and have told me that I’ll definitely have fun with him on the pitch.

“I hope that he’ll be able to take us further with his goals. I’m sure he’s happy to be here and to be able to play with us, and we’re pleased to be able to assist him and help him to score as many goals as possible.”

Lacazette officially joined Arsenal for £52m on Wednesday, becoming the club’s record signing in the process. Arsenal’s previous record was Mesut Ozil himself.

He was very prolific in France, and fans will be hoping that he can be even more so with the service of Ozil and Alexis.
